Yes, that's what I have found works better than coming over the stern. It's much easier to clamber over the side without the rail and rigging in the way. Newer models have a walk-thru stern rail, but you still had to get around the backstays, traveler, stern seats, and whatever else might be back there. I hook a ladder over the side right next to the cabin. You also have the handrail right there, so it's much easier to get a grip on something to get yourself up and over the side when climbing aboard.
